Currently ranked No. 58 in the world, Germany’s Michael Berrer achieved a career-best ranking of 42nd during the 2010 season.
Berrer turned pro in 1999 at age 19, but did not crack the ATP top 100 rankings until 2007. That season he reached the main draw of the Australian Open by winning three qualifying matches, and made deep runs at several Challenger events. At Hertogenbosch, he made the quarterfinals, upsetting No. 17 Guillermo Canas in the process, to move up to No. 94, his first time in the Top 100. He followed that up with a first-round upset of Albert Montanes at Wimbledon, and reachd the quarterfinals at Los Angeles, the third round at Washington D.C., the second round at the US Open and the semifinals at Moscow to finish the year 57th.
He fell back out of the Top 100 in 2008, but regained his form the following season. He reached the second round of the Australian Open while ranked No. 134, and re-entered the Top 100 after winning the Challengers at Bratislava and Salzburg, finishing the year 74th.
His strong play to end 2009 carried over into 2010 as he reached the finals at Zagreb, taking down Janko Tipsarevic and Viktor Troicki in the process. Berrer reached the quarterfinals at Dubai and the third round at Monte Carlo to reach a career-best No. 42 in the world. He went on to reach the semifinals at Vienna with wins over two Top 30 players, but an upset in the first round at Paris followed by no play the rest of the year saw him drop back to No. 66.
Year-End Singles Rankings: 2002 – 352nd; 2003 – 326th; 2004 – 235th; 2005 – 126th; 2006 – 152nd; 2007 – 57th; 2008 – 131st; 2009 – 74th; 2010 – 66th.
Personal
Began playing tennis at age seven. Follows soccer closely, particularly his hometown team from Stuttgart. His coach is Claudio Pistolesi.
